The right resume template does more than look attractive — it signals professionalism, guides the reader's eye to your strengths, and ensures your content parses cleanly through applicant tracking systems. Here's how to match a template to your field and career stage.
Modern: versatile and widely flattering
A modern template with a prominent header works well across most industries, from tech and marketing to operations and design-adjacent roles. It balances contemporary style with readability, making it a safe default when you're unsure.
Executive: authority for senior roles
If you're applying for management, director, or C-suite positions, an executive layout communicates gravitas. Clean lines and a corporate structure put the focus on leadership experience and measurable business results.
Minimalist: clarity above all
For highly competitive or traditional fields — finance, law, academia, engineering — a minimalist template signals substance over style. It maximizes readability and lets your accomplishments speak for themselves without visual distraction.
Creative: stand out in visual fields
Designers, marketers, and other creative professionals can use a bolder layout with a distinctive sidebar to demonstrate their eye for design. Just make sure the creativity enhances rather than obscures the content — and confirm the template still parses well for online applications.
Match the template to the company culture
A startup may appreciate a modern or creative look, while a large financial institution will expect something more conservative. When in doubt, research the company and lean slightly more formal than you think you need to.
Keep ATS compatibility in mind
